| The ability to measure accurately
and easily the moisture of a given product on-line, has tremendous benefits for
productivity and quality control. The difficulty has been that the product to be
measured is constantly changing as it moves by a moisture sensor. These changes have
included layer thickness, density, particle size, volatile matter content, color,
and temperature. The Berthold Moisture Analyzer is able to make moisture measurements that have not been
able to be made by other technologies. Berthold has two moisture
measurement products available, LB456 Microwave
Moisture Analyzer and LB350
Neutron Moisture Analyzer.
LB456 Microwave Moisture Analyzer
Typical Applications -- Pipe, Chute, or Belt
Berthold's MICRO-MOIST has been developed for non-contacting
accurate on-line determination of the water content of many different materials. The
product to be measured can be on a moving belt, in a chute, or in a pipe.
The MICRO-MOIST amplifier develops multiple microwave
frequencies in wide frequency range. It then sends the microwave signals to a
transmitting horn which directs them through the material to be measured and then are
collected in a receiving horn on the opposite side, where they are sent back to the
amplifier for evaluation.
The microprocessor has the unique ability to measure
attenuation and/or phase shift for each frequency generated. This results in a very
accurate moisture measurement that is negligibly affected by temperature, particle size or
volatile matter.
Since the measurement is carried out as a transmission
measurement, the entire material transmitted will be analyzed which will ensure a
representative value even in those cases where the moisture is distributed
non-homogeneously.
